    In Bathurst, the question of whether an esthetician can perform microneedling is a common one, given the growing popularity of this skin rejuvenation treatment. Microneedling, also known as collagen induction therapy, involves using fine needles to create micro-injuries in the skin, which stimulates collagen production and promotes skin renewal.

    In Bathurst, the ability of an esthetician to perform microneedling depends on local regulations and the specific qualifications of the professional. Generally, estheticians are trained in various skincare treatments, including facials, peels, and other non-invasive procedures. However, microneedling can be considered a more advanced treatment due to its potential to penetrate the skin and the need for precise technique to avoid complications.

    In many jurisdictions, microneedling may require a higher level of certification or supervision by a medical professional, such as a dermatologist or nurse. This is to ensure that the procedure is performed safely and effectively, especially for clients with specific skin conditions or concerns.

    If you are considering microneedling in Bathurst, it is advisable to consult with your chosen skincare professional to understand their qualifications and the specific protocols they follow. This will help you make an informed decision and ensure that you receive the best possible care for your skin. Always prioritize safety and efficacy when choosing any cosmetic treatment.

    Microneedling, also known as collagen induction therapy, involves using fine needles to create controlled micro-injuries in the skin. These injuries stimulate the body's natural healing process, promoting the production of collagen and elastin, which are vital for skin rejuvenation. However, the effectiveness and safety of this procedure heavily depend on the expertise and training of the practitioner.

    The Role of Qualifications and Training

    An esthetician performing microneedling should have undergone specialized training in this specific technique. This training should include not only the technical aspects of the procedure but also an understanding of skin biology, potential complications, and appropriate aftercare. In Bathurst, it is advisable to choose an esthetician who is certified by a reputable institution and has a proven track record of successful treatments.

    Adherence to Standard Protocols

    Following standard protocols is another critical aspect of safe and effective microneedling. These protocols typically include sterilization procedures for the equipment, proper skin preparation, and the use of appropriate needle depths based on the client's skin type and condition. Deviation from these protocols can lead to complications such as infection, scarring, or uneven skin texture.
